Transaction 07e95f9ebbcad02a48d1d4e38769b986631b2f18ac8cf4bb44daff50f3c76725

5 Input
2 Outputs
  • 07e95f9ebbcad02a48d1d4e38769b986631b2f18ac8cf4bb44daff50f3c76725:0
  • value  24517668
    address  bc1qru76jkfmptk754czr2fknzmmjv5r6ymqskx6w2
  • 07e95f9ebbcad02a48d1d4e38769b986631b2f18ac8cf4bb44daff50f3c76725:1
  • value  1500000000
    address  18Xmi27sVvSGD8rA2X2naWTqGtqfaB1k2k